Rektör

Prof.  Dr. Abdullah Y. ÖZTOPRAK 



Özgeçmiş (CV)


Doğu Akdeniz Üniversitesi Mühendislik Fakültesi Elektrik ve Elektronik Mühendisliği

Tel: +90-392-630 1200

e-posta:  abdullah.oztoprak@emu.edu.tr


Eğitim:  

1977 University College London, Unıversity of London Elektrik ve ElektronikMühendisliği     Doktora  
1973 University College London, Unıversity of London  Elektrik ve ElektronikMühendisliği    Lisans

Akademik Unvanlar:  

Profesör   Elektrik ve Elektronik Müh.                   DAÜ 1997-
Doçent Elektrik ve Elektronik Müh.                        DAÜ 1988-1997
Yardımcı Doçent Elektrik ve Elektronik Müh.             DAÜ 1986-1988

İdari Görevler:
Mühendislik F. Dekanlığı Doğu Akdeniz Üniversitesi 2003-2004
Rektör Yardımcısı-Akademik Doğu Akdeniz Üniversitesi 1992-2003
Enstitü Müdürlüğü(LEÖAE) Doğu Akdeniz Üniversitesi  1991-1993
Bölüm Başkanlığı    Elektrik ve Elektronik Mühendisliği Doğu Akdeniz Üniversitesi 1989-1992
Cypruvex (UK) Müdürlüğü Londra 1983-1986
Anten Araştırma Bir. Sorumlusu Marcony Space and Defence Systems 1981- 1983
